Patents by Inventor Mark Patrick Delaney

Mark Patrick Delaney has filed for patents to protect the following inventions. This listing includes patent applications that are pending as well as patents that have already been granted by the United States Patent and Trademark Office (USPTO).

  • Patent number: 11083036
    Abstract: In one aspect, a first device that may be disposed on a vehicle may include at least one processor and storage accessible to the at least one processor. The storage may include instructions executable by the at least one processor to communicate with second and third devices to heuristically determine which of the second and third devices to use to execute a function at the first device. The instructions may also be executable to select one of the second and third devices based on the determination and to, based on the selection, communicate with the selected device to execute the function at the first device.
    Type: Grant
    Filed: May 27, 2020
    Date of Patent: August 3, 2021
    Assignee: Lenovo (Singapore) Pte. Ltd.
    Inventors: Arnold S. Weksler, Mark Patrick Delaney, Russell Speight VanBlon, Nathan J. Peterson, John Carl Mese
  • Publication number: 20210216138
    Abstract: Apparatuses, methods, systems, and program products are disclosed for controlling input focus based on eye gaze. An apparatus includes a processor and a memory that stores code executable by the processor. The code is executable by the processor to determine a location of a user's eye gaze on the display device. The code is executable by the processor to determine an application window presented on the display device that corresponds to the determined location of the user's eye gaze. The code is executable by the processor to ignore input in response to the determined application window that corresponds to the location of the user's eye gaze not having focus.
    Type: Application
    Filed: January 9, 2020
    Publication date: July 15, 2021
    Inventors: Arnold S. Weksler, John Carl Mese, Nathan J. Peterson, Russell Speight VanBlon, Mark Patrick Delaney
  • Publication number: 20210216810
    Abstract: An approach is provided that receiving a set of images. Each of the received images was taken at an unknown location. Features from the set of images are compared to features found in a second set of images, where the second set of images were each taken at a known location. The comparison results in a location that is common to the set of images that were received. This resulting location is then associated with each of the images in the received set of images.
    Type: Application
    Filed: January 9, 2020
    Publication date: July 15, 2021
    Inventors: Nathan J. Peterson, Russell Speight VanBlon, Mark Patrick Delaney, Arnold S. Weksler, John C. Mese
  • Publication number: 20210210083
    Abstract: One embodiment provides a method, including: receiving at a digital personal assistant coupled to an information handling device, while receiving a command from a first user, an input from a second user; determining that the input provided by the second user is directed at the first user; providing an indication indicating the command is directed to the digital personal assistant; and ignoring the input provided by the second user. Other aspects are described and claimed.
    Type: Application
    Filed: January 6, 2020
    Publication date: July 8, 2021
    Inventors: Arnold S. Weksler, John Carl Mese, Nathan J. Peterson, Mark Patrick Delaney, Russell Speight VanBlon
  • Patent number: 11048462
    Abstract: In one aspect, a device includes a processor, first and second video displays accessible to the processor, and storage accessible to the processor and including instructions executable by the processor to present on a task bar of at least one of the video displays at least a first selector selectable to cause a first application to be presented on the first video display and a second application to be presented on the second video display, and to present on the task bar at least a second selector selectable to cause a third application to be presented on the first video display and a fourth application to be presented on the second video display.
    Type: Grant
    Filed: February 14, 2020
    Date of Patent: June 29, 2021
    Assignee: Lenovo (Singapore) Pte. Ltd.
    Inventors: Nathan J. Peterson, Arnold S. Weksler, Russell Speight VanBlon, John Carl Mese, Mark Patrick Delaney
  • Patent number: 11036375
    Abstract: For dynamic zoom based on media, a processor detects a zoom event. The zoom event includes a tap on a touch screen. The zoom event is located at a displayed media and includes a zoom location. The processor further determines a media profile for the zoom event. The processor calculates a zoom percentage based on the zoom event and the media profile. The processor further presents the displayed media resized by the zoom percentage on the touch screen.
    Type: Grant
    Filed: February 20, 2020
    Date of Patent: June 15, 2021
    Assignee: Lenovo (Singapore) PTE. LTD.
    Inventors: Mark Patrick Delaney, John C. Mese, Nathan J. Peterson, Russell S. VanBlon, Arnold S. Weksler
  • Patent number: 11030882
    Abstract: For automated security subsystem activation, a processor monitors occupant activity from a plurality of electronic devices. The processor further determines the occupant activity satisfies a quiescence model. The processor activates the security subsystem in response to satisfying the quiescence model.
    Type: Grant
    Filed: March 11, 2019
    Date of Patent: June 8, 2021
    Assignee: Lenovo (Singapore) PTE. LTD.
    Inventors: Nathan J. Peterson, Russell Speight VanBlon, John Carl Mese, Mark Patrick Delaney
  • Publication number: 20210160671
    Abstract: An approach is provided that connects an information handling system, such as a media console included in an automobile, to a number of devices using Bluetooth connections. The approach connects the information handling system to the devices. Each of the devices is associated with a user and there may be multiple users with each user having one or more of the devices. A request is received from one of the users and a device is identified that is associated with the user from whom the request was received. The request is then fulfilled by utilizing one of the devices.
    Type: Application
    Filed: November 22, 2019
    Publication date: May 27, 2021
    Inventors: Arnold S. Weksler, John C. Mese, Nathan J. Peterson, Russell Speight VanBlon, Mark Patrick Delaney
  • Patent number: 11017044
    Abstract: Apparatuses, methods, and program products are disclosed for filtering similar content items. One apparatus includes a processor and a memory that stores code executable by the processor. The code is executable by the processor to compare, by use of the processor, a content item to previous content items corresponding to an account. The code is executable by the processor to determine whether the content item is a similar content item for the account based on the comparison between the content item and the previous content items. The code is executable by the processor to, in response to the content item being a similar content item for the account, determine whether to filter the content item from the account.
    Type: Grant
    Filed: August 30, 2018
    Date of Patent: May 25, 2021
    Assignee: Lenovo (Singapore) PTE. LTD.
    Inventors: Mark Patrick Delaney, Nathan J. Peterson, John Carl Mese, Russell Speight VanBlon
  • Patent number: 11019185
    Abstract: One embodiment provides a method, including: detecting, at a network device and from an information handling device, a request to connect to a network; receiving, from the information handling device, an indication of an expected data usage to be used by the information handling device on the network; enabling, responsive to approving of the expected data usage, the information handling device to connect to the network; determining, using a processor, whether an actual data usage by the information handling device is different than the expected data usage; and performing, responsive to determining that the actual data usage is different than the expected data usage, an action. Other aspects are described and claimed.
    Type: Grant
    Filed: March 30, 2020
    Date of Patent: May 25, 2021
    Assignee: Lenovo (Singapore) Pte. Ltd.
    Inventors: Russell Speight VanBlon, Nathan J. Peterson, Arnold S. Weksler, Mark Patrick Delaney, John Carl Mese
  • Publication number: 20210149503
    Abstract: One embodiment provides a method, including: detecting, at a wireless charger integrated into an electronic device, a connection of a wearable accessory device, wherein the wireless charger is positioned proximate to a probable user contact position; and transmitting, using the wireless charger and during a period when the connection is established, a charge to the wearable accessory device; wherein the wearable accessory device is worn by a user during the connection. Other aspects are described and claimed.
    Type: Application
    Filed: November 18, 2019
    Publication date: May 20, 2021
    Inventors: Russell Speight VanBlon, Nathan J. Peterson, Mark Patrick Delaney, John Carl Mese, Arnold S. Weksler
  • Publication number: 20210149946
    Abstract: In one aspect, a device may include at least one processor and storage accessible to the at least one processor. The storage may include instructions executable by the at least one processor to receive user input selecting a portion of an image, where the portion of the image may not include the entirety of the image. The instructions may also be executable to, based on the user input, perform a reverse image search using the portion of the image but not the entirety of the image.
    Type: Application
    Filed: November 19, 2019
    Publication date: May 20, 2021
    Inventors: Russell Speight VanBlon, Mark Patrick Delaney, Nathan J. Peterson, John Carl Mese, Arnold S. Weksler
  • Patent number: 10999232
    Abstract: For adaptive notification, a processor determines a message sentiment of a message. The processor further determines a sender relationship of a sender of the message to a recipient. The processor determines a notification urgency for the message to the recipient from a notification model based on the message sentiment and the sender relationship. The processor communicates a notification of the message to the recipient based on the notification urgency.
    Type: Grant
    Filed: February 25, 2019
    Date of Patent: May 4, 2021
    Assignee: Lenovo (Singapore) PTE. LTD.
    Inventors: Mark Patrick Delaney, John Carl Mese, Nathan J. Peterson, Russell Speight VanBlon
  • Patent number: 10991139
    Abstract: In one aspect, a device includes at least one processor, a display accessible to the at least one processor, and storage accessible to the at least one processor. The storage includes instructions executable by the at least one processor to identify an item from an image presentable on the display. The instructions are also executable to arrange presentation on the display of one or more of the images and at least one graphical object so that the at least one graphical object is not overlaid on top of the item while the image is presented on the display concurrently with the at least one graphical object.
    Type: Grant
    Filed: August 30, 2018
    Date of Patent: April 27, 2021
    Assignee: Lenovo (Singapore) Pte. Ltd.
    Inventors: Nathan J. Peterson, Russell Speight VanBlon, John Carl Mese, Mark Patrick Delaney
  • Publication number: 20210096641
    Abstract: Apparatuses, methods, systems, and program products are disclosed for input control display based on eye gaze. An apparatus includes an eye-tracking device, an input device, a processor, and a memory that stores code executable by the processor. The code is executable to track an eye gaze of a user in relation to a display using the eye-tracking device, determine one or more interface controls presented on the display that are within an area of the user's eye gaze, and dynamically map the determined one or more interface controls to one or more corresponding input controls on the input device such that actuation of an input control on the input device activates the corresponding interface control presented on the display.
    Type: Application
    Filed: September 26, 2019
    Publication date: April 1, 2021
    Inventors: Russell Speight VanBlon, Mark Patrick Delaney, Nathan J. Peterson, John Carl Mese, Arnold S. Weksler
  • Publication number: 20210099743
    Abstract: Apparatuses, methods, systems, and program products are disclosed for presenting content based on network bandwidth. An apparatus includes a processor and a memory that stores code executable by the processor. The code is executable to determine a content element to be presented from a remote location, determine an amount of network bandwidth that is necessary to present the content element from the remote location, and present the content element in response to the amount of network bandwidth that is necessary to present the content satisfying a predefined network bandwidth.
    Type: Application
    Filed: September 27, 2019
    Publication date: April 1, 2021
    Inventors: John Carl Mese, Nathan J. Peterson, Arnold S. Weksler, Mark Patrick Delaney, Russell Speight VanBlon
  • Publication number: 20210096737
    Abstract: In one aspect, a device may include at least one processor, a display accessible to the at least one processor, and storage accessible to the at least one processor. The storage may include instructions executable by the at least one processor to identify, in a first instance, a first height of a hover of a portion of a user's body over the display. The instructions may also be executable to correlate the first height to a first user input parameter and to execute at least a first operation at the device in conformance with the first user input parameter.
    Type: Application
    Filed: September 30, 2019
    Publication date: April 1, 2021
    Inventors: Arnold S. Weksler, Mark Patrick Delaney, Russell Speight VanBlon, Nathan J. Peterson, John Carl Mese
  • Patent number: 10963320
    Abstract: For presenting a hygiene warning, a processor detects satisfying a risk policy. The risk policy is satisfied in response to a touch of an electronic device by a user. The processor presents a hygiene warning on the electronic device in response to satisfying the risk policy.
    Type: Grant
    Filed: March 27, 2020
    Date of Patent: March 30, 2021
    Assignee: Lenovo (Singapore) PTE. LTD.
    Inventors: John Carl Mese, Mark Patrick Delaney, Nathan J. Peterson, Russell Speight VanBlon, Arnold S. Weksler
  • Publication number: 20210092024
    Abstract: In one aspect, an apparatus includes at least one processor and storage accessible to the at least one processor. The storage may include instructions executable by the at least one processor to predict that a device will not have a network connection during a period of time. Based on the prediction, the instructions may also be executable to recommend content to cache at the device in advance of the period of time and/or to automatically cache the content.
    Type: Application
    Filed: September 20, 2019
    Publication date: March 25, 2021
    Inventors: Mark Patrick Delaney, Nathan J. Peterson, Russell Speight VanBlon, Arnold S. Weksler, John Carl Mese
  • Patent number: 10956613
    Abstract: One embodiments provides a method, including: determining, using a processor, whether content to be displayed on an information handling device comprises sensitive information; filtering, responsive to determining that the content comprises sensitive information, the sensitive information from the content; displaying, on a display of the information handling device, the content with the sensitive information filtered; and transmitting the sensitive information to a secondary device. Other aspects are described and claimed.
    Type: Grant
    Filed: September 12, 2018
    Date of Patent: March 23, 2021
    Assignee: Lenovo (Singapore) Pte. Ltd.
    Inventors: Russell Speight VanBlon, Nathan J. Peterson, Mark Patrick Delaney, John Carl Mese